Halloween night (2021)
This year we did a graveyard theme with a crypt, many tombstones and a large scarecrow. I used LED spotlights that allowed me to pick colors to get the effect I wanted. I mounted them to the gutters, behind bushes, and around the graveyard. I also used smoke machines and speakers to play custom made spooky soundtracks. I was very inspired by Universal Studios’ Halloween Horror Nights. There is also a giant spider web lit with blacklight and window projections. See the 2021 Walkthrough

The entrance
This is the entrance to the “scare zone”. Made from an old tarp and PVC pipe. Once someone walks through, they are immediately scared by an actor hiding in the crypt.
The scare zone
As people would enter the scare zone, an actor presses a button in the crypt that plays a loud scream as they jump out of the crypt. They are then surprised by more actors and 3 different animatronics. One is triggered by a large step pad we made, and others were automated, timed and sync’d with sound effects.
The fence (reclaimed wood)
I had the idea to make a rickety fence this year and planned to use old shipping pallets for the wood. But then I found a neighbor that was gutting his basement and throwing away the materials. I brought the wood home and removed or bent all of the nails down so it would be safe. Then I made 13 fence sections to surround our front yard and added some paint to try and make it look little bit weathered and older.

The jumping spider
This a store-bought prop but I hid it in an old trunk, covered it with spider webs and added lighting. I made a large step pad to use as a trigger and connected it to the spider. Trick-or-treaters could not pass by without triggering the prop.
